Tempura Batter Recipe
Light and crispy tempura batter perfect for frying vegetables and seafood.

Ingredients
Tempura Batter Ingredients
1
cup
All-purpose flour
1
cup
Ice water
1
large
Egg
0.5
teaspoon
Baking soda
Instructions
In a mixing bowl, whisk the egg until frothy.
Add the ice water to the egg and mix well.
Gradually add the flour and baking soda to the mixture, stirring lightly. Do not overmix; the batter should be slightly lumpy.
Use immediately for best results. Dip vegetables or seafood into the batter and fry until golden brown.
